This commit is contained in:
夏菊 2025-04-19 10:06:38 +08:00
parent a71c6597e1
commit 712d027ae3
1 changed files with 36 additions and 71 deletions

View File

@ -57,8 +57,7 @@
</div> </div>
</div> </div>
<!-- 预警警报 --> <!-- 预警警报 -->
<div id="Early" class="block" style=" height: 2.1rem; <div id="Early" class="block" style="height: 2.1rem;margin-top: 0.25rem;">
margin-top: 0.25rem;">
<div class="block-tit"><span>预警警报</span></div> <div class="block-tit"><span>预警警报</span></div>
<div class="block-main"> <div class="block-main">
<div class="early-box"> <div class="early-box">
@ -81,8 +80,7 @@
</div> </div>
</div> </div>
<!-- 安全/质量问题 --> <!-- 安全/质量问题 -->
<div id="check" class="block" style=" height: 2.1rem; <div id="check" class="block" style="height: 2.1rem;margin-top: 0.25rem;">
margin-top: 0.25rem;">
<div class="block-tit"> <div class="block-tit">
<div :class="[checkIdx == 0?'selected':'']" @click="onChangeCheck(0)"><span>安全检查</span></div> <div :class="[checkIdx == 0?'selected':'']" @click="onChangeCheck(0)"><span>安全检查</span></div>
<div :class="[checkIdx == 1?'selected':'']" @click="onChangeCheck(1)"><span>质量检查</span></div> <div :class="[checkIdx == 1?'selected':'']" @click="onChangeCheck(1)"><span>质量检查</span></div>
@ -125,8 +123,7 @@
</div> </div>
</div> </div>
<!-- 风险分级管控 --> <!-- 风险分级管控 -->
<div id="risk" class="block" style=" height: 1.725rem; <div id="risk" class="block" style="height: 1.725rem;margin-top: 0.25rem;">
margin-top: 0.25rem;">
<div class="block-tit"><span>风险分级管控</span></div> <div class="block-tit"><span>风险分级管控</span></div>
<div class="block-main"> <div class="block-main">
<div class="box"> <div class="box">
@ -160,14 +157,12 @@
</div> </div>
</div> </div>
<!-- 费用、机具及会议 --> <!-- 费用、机具及会议 -->
<div id="tools" class="block" style=" height: 2.15rem; <div id="tools" class="block" style="height: 2.15rem;margin-top: 0.25rem;">
margin-top: 0.25rem;">
<div class="block-tit"><span>费用、机具及会议</span></div> <div class="block-tit"><span>费用、机具及会议</span></div>
<div class="block-main"> <div class="block-main">
<div class="t-box"> <div class="t-box">
<div class="t-box-tit"> <div class="t-box-tit">
<i class="iconfont icon-l10" style=" color: #FFBF46; <i class="iconfont icon-l10" style="color: #FFBF46;font-size: 20px;"></i>
font-size: 20px;"></i>
<p>安全费用</p> <p>安全费用</p>
</div> </div>
<div class="r-row"> <div class="r-row">
@ -181,8 +176,7 @@
</div> </div>
<div class="t-box"> <div class="t-box">
<div class="t-box-tit"> <div class="t-box-tit">
<i class="iconfont icon-l10" style=" color: #00DEFF; <i class="iconfont icon-l10" style="color: #00DEFF;font-size: 20px;"></i>
font-size: 20px;"></i>
<p>施工机具设备</p> <p>施工机具设备</p>
</div> </div>
<div class="r-row"> <div class="r-row">
@ -196,8 +190,7 @@
</div> </div>
<div class="t-box"> <div class="t-box">
<div class="t-box-tit"> <div class="t-box-tit">
<i class="iconfont icon-l10" style=" color: #00DEFF; <i class="iconfont icon-l10" style="color: #00DEFF;font-size: 20px;"></i>
font-size: 20px;"></i>
<p>会议</p> <p>会议</p>
</div> </div>
<div class="r-row"> <div class="r-row">
@ -243,10 +236,8 @@
<!-- 项目进度计划 --> <!-- 项目进度计划 -->
<div id="xmjd" class="block4" style="height: 1.8875rem;"> <div id="xmjd" class="block4" style="height: 1.8875rem;">
<div class="block4-tit"><span>项目进度计划</span></div> <div class="block4-tit"><span>项目进度计划</span></div>
<div class="block4-main" style=" width: 10rem; <div class="block4-main" style="width: 10rem;">
"> <div style="overflow-x: scroll; height: 100%;">
<div style=" overflow-x: scroll;
height: 100%;">
<div class="xm-plan"> <div class="xm-plan">
<div v-for="(item,idx) in form.xmjdData" ::key="idx" :class="['z-plan-item', item.isClosed?'closed':'undone']"> <div v-for="(item,idx) in form.xmjdData" ::key="idx" :class="['z-plan-item', item.isClosed?'closed':'undone']">
<div class="z-line" > <div class="z-line" >
@ -303,11 +294,7 @@
</div> </div>
</div> </div>
<!-- 应急管理数据 / 工程划分 --> <!-- 应急管理数据 / 工程划分 -->
<div class="layout" <div class="layout" style="height: 1.85rem;display: grid;grid-template-columns: 5.5rem 4.25rem;gap: 0.25rem;">
style=" height: 1.85rem;
display: grid;
grid-template-columns: 5.5rem 4.25rem;
gap: 0.25rem;">
<div id="yjgl" class="block5" style="height: 100%;"> <div id="yjgl" class="block5" style="height: 100%;">
<div class="block5-tit"><span>应急管理数据</span></div> <div class="block5-tit"><span>应急管理数据</span></div>
<div class="block5-main"> <div class="block5-main">
@ -371,10 +358,7 @@
</div> </div>
<div class="side"> <div class="side">
<!-- 特种设备质保体系 / 图纸会审/设计交底 --> <!-- 特种设备质保体系 / 图纸会审/设计交底 -->
<div class="layout" style=" height: 1.7rem; <div class="layout" style="height: 1.7rem;display: grid;grid-template-columns: 1fr 1fr;gap: 0.25rem;">
display: grid;
grid-template-columns: 1fr 1fr;
gap: 0.25rem;">
<div class="block1" id="tzsb"> <div class="block1" id="tzsb">
<div class="block-tit1"><span>特种设备质保体系</span></div> <div class="block-tit1"><span>特种设备质保体系</span></div>
<div class="block1-main"> <div class="block1-main">
@ -401,8 +385,7 @@
</div> </div>
</div> </div>
<!-- 培训教育 --> <!-- 培训教育 -->
<div id="educat" class="block" style=" height: 2.2rem; <div id="educat" class="block" style="height: 2.2rem;margin-top: 0.25rem;">
margin-top: 0.25rem;">
<div class="block-tit"> <div class="block-tit">
<div :class="[educationIdx == 0?'selected':'']" @click="onChangeEducation(0)"><span>安全教育</span> <div :class="[educationIdx == 0?'selected':'']" @click="onChangeEducation(0)"><span>安全教育</span>
</div> </div>
@ -466,8 +449,7 @@
</div> </div>
</div> </div>
<!-- 报验记录 --> <!-- 报验记录 -->
<div id="byjl" class="block" style=" height: 2.5375rem; <div id="byjl" class="block" style="height: 2.5375rem;margin-top: 0.25rem;">
margin-top: 0.25rem;">
<div class="block-tit"><span>报验记录</span></div> <div class="block-tit"><span>报验记录</span></div>
<div class="block-main"> <div class="block-main">
<div class="byjl"> <div class="byjl">
@ -478,10 +460,7 @@
<div class="row"> <div class="row">
<h6>合格率</h6> <h6>合格率</h6>
<div class="bar"> <div class="bar">
<div :style=" <div :style="{width: form.inspectionRecord.equipmentRate+'%'}" class="bar-inner"></div>
{
width: form.inspectionRecord.equipmentRate+'%'
}" class="bar-inner"></div>
</div> </div>
</div> </div>
</div> </div>
@ -492,10 +471,7 @@
<div class="row"> <div class="row">
<h6>合格率</h6> <h6>合格率</h6>
<div class="bar"> <div class="bar">
<div :style=" <div :style="{width: form.inspectionRecord.machineRate+'%'}" class="bar-inner"></div>
{
width: form.inspectionRecord.machineRate+'%'
}" class="bar-inner"></div>
</div> </div>
</div> </div>
</div> </div>
@ -506,24 +482,15 @@
<div class="row"> <div class="row">
<h6>合格率</h6> <h6>合格率</h6>
<div class="bar"> <div class="bar">
<div :style=" <div :style="{width: form.inspectionRecord.personRate+'%'}" class="bar-inner"></div>
{
width: form.inspectionRecord.personRate+'%'
}" class="bar-inner"></div>
</div> </div>
</div> </div>
</div> </div>
</div> </div>
</div> </div>
</div> </div>
<!-- 施工方案 / 高风险作业许可 --> <!-- 施工方案 / 高风险作业许可 -->
<div class="layout" <div class="layout" style="height: 2.1875rem;margin-top: 0.25rem;display: grid;grid-template-columns: 3.75rem 2.25rem;gap: 0.25rem;">
style=" height: 2.1875rem;
margin-top: 0.25rem;
display: grid;
grid-template-columns: 3.75rem 2.25rem;
gap: 0.25rem;">
<div class="block2" id="sgfa"> <div class="block2" id="sgfa">
<div class="block2-tit"><span>施工方案</span></div> <div class="block2-tit"><span>施工方案</span></div>
<div class="block2-main"> <div class="block2-main">
@ -565,8 +532,7 @@
</div> </div>
</div> </div>
<!-- 计量器具数据 --> <!-- 计量器具数据 -->
<div id="jlqj" class="block" style=" height: 1.975rem; <div id="jlqj" class="block" style="height: 1.975rem;margin-top: 0.25rem;">
margin-top: 0.25rem;">
<div class="block-tit"><span>计量器具数据</span></div> <div class="block-tit"><span>计量器具数据</span></div>
<div class="block-main"> <div class="block-main">
<div class="jlqj"> <div class="jlqj">
@ -592,7 +558,6 @@
</div> </div>
</div> </div>
</body> </body>
</html> </html>
<script src="../res/lib/vue.min.js"></script> <script src="../res/lib/vue.min.js"></script>
<script src="../res/lib/echarts.min.js"></script> <script src="../res/lib/echarts.min.js"></script>